Softcreate Holdings' (TSE:3371) Shareholders Will Receive A Bigger Dividend Than Last Year
Softcreate Holdings Corp. (TSE:3371) has announced that it will be increasing its dividend from last year's comparable payment on the 4th of December to ¥27.50. This will take the dividend yield to an attractive 3.0%, providing a nice boost to shareholder returns.

Softcreate Holdings' Dividend Is Well Covered By Earnings
If the payments aren't sustainable, a high yield for a few years won't matter that much. However, Softcreate Holdings' earnings easily cover the dividend. This means that most of its earnings are being retained to grow the business.
Looking forward, earnings per share could rise by 24.1% over the next year if the trend from the last few years continues. If the dividend continues on this path, the payout ratio could be 37% by next year, which we think can be pretty sustainable going forward.
Softcreate Holdings Has A Solid Track Record
The company has an extended history of paying stable dividends. The annual payment during the last 10 years was ¥8.50 in 2014, and the most recent fiscal year payment was ¥55.00. This means that it has been growing its distributions at 21% per annum over that time. It is good to see that there has been strong dividend growth, and that there haven't been any cuts for a long time.
The Dividend Looks Likely To Grow
Investors could be attracted to the stock based on the quality of its payment history. It's encouraging to see that Softcreate Holdings has been growing its earnings per share at 24% a year over the past five years. Rapid earnings growth and a low payout ratio suggest this company has been effectively reinvesting in its business. Should that continue, this company could have a bright future.
Softcreate Holdings Looks Like A Great Dividend Stock
Overall, we think this could be an attractive income stock, and it is only getting better by paying a higher dividend this year. Distributions are quite easily covered by earnings, which are also being converted to cash flows. All of these factors considered, we think this has solid potential as a dividend stock.
